LCC Posted September 8, 2011 Report Share Posted September 8, 2011 The main problems here are the rad/gen and blade. Lightening the load allows for more frame defense and B1000 is the only gen worth using. The blade just sucks, never hits, and drain/weighs more than it's worth. T100 is far superior as a general blade as it recovers faster and takes less commitment. Starter or en efficient blade are best if you use it for positioning and don't intend to actually use it as an offensive tool. The high radiator is not needed in vs mode. You can easily get away with CM6 or A3. Single player has higher heat values so it shouldn't be used to test it. What I came up with: ROCKROOK2112LAPINGEX3000BLAZERB1000COT1550MQ2BRM04BAL4BAL4NIGHT3443 Screens, LE, CIRK, E++ If you play hard mode you should use VIECH. You can even try turn boosters with CIRK removed and use both E++ and VIECH, also applies to normal mode. BRM04 complements BAL4 as a major method of dodging it is to boost directly through it if fired directly. BRM04 forces a different dodging pattern or gives you easy damage. BAL4 horizonatlly dodged often results in hits due to the larger spread area compared to IMU. If you want to go max defense you could throw in STVM legs with AA00 side shields and 707/E arms too. Another option is to use PRT insides, BAMS287 extension, and CM6 radiator. This helps to control space vs XA2 lights and adds random almost guaranteed damage.
